Adding further intrigue to the project, acclaimed actor Jisshu U Sengupta will be seen in a pivotal role, making the ensemble even more exciting for cinephiles.
Bohurupi: The Golden Daku has been written by Nandita Roy and Shiboprosad Mukherjee, who also return to direct the film. The film features a strong technical and creative team. Story and script are by Nandita Roy and Shiboprosad Mukherjee, with dialogues by Shiboprosad Mukherjee. Cinematography is by Animesh Ghorui, while editing is handled by Malay Laha. Makeup is by Papiya Chanda, and the art direction team includes Mridul Baidya and Saswati Karmakar. Choreography has been done by Mangesh Khedekar (Maggi).
The music of the film brings together an eclectic mix of artistes including Nonichora Das Baul, Bonnie Chakraborty, Anupam Roy, Arnab Dutta and Silajit Majumder, promising a vibrant and memorable soundtrack.
The shoot for Bohurupi: The Golden Daku is scheduled to take place across March and April.
